BOZEMAN – Saturday was a beautiful day for America’s pastime as the Helena Senators traveled to Bozeman to play the Bucks in a Class AA legion baseball doubleheader.

The first game started as a defensive duel between both squads, but Bozeman opened up the flood gates in the third inning. Ethan Coleman slapped an opposite-field single and one run came into score making it 2-0 heading into the fourth. The Bucks kept the offense going in the fourth, as Logan Paithorpe dropped a single over the second baseman’s head to score another run and giving Bozeman a 4-0 lead going into the fifth.

But the Senators weren’t going to roll over. Matt Kieger ripped a single through the left side and their first run of the day came across the plate, 6-1 Bozeman at this point. Later in that same inning, Rudy Barkley hit a moonshot to deep right center as part of a five-run fifth for the Senators. However, that’d be as close as they get, asBozeman held on for 7-5 win in game one.

Game two gave Helena it’s revenge, as it cruised to a 13-2 win over the Bucks. Hunter Kirkpatrick and Eithan Keintz combine to allow only two runs for the Senators, who improve to 4-2 overall and Bozeman falls to 3-3 overall.
